We took my dad's car ('94) to the track Friday night, he ran a 14.6... eh. That was with a 4000 stall, 15 psi, hallow cats, and a weak launch. But the track was slippery and he would spin through second instead of building any boost. Unhappy with that, he now has the trick done where both turbos are on all the time, and it is a HUGE difference. We went out and ran it with my iPhone and got a 13.5 @ 15psi (had better traction on the road than we did at the track...) and my iPhone usually reads a couple tenths faster than what the car actually does, I tested it several times at the track before.

The only problem he has with the car is if he tries to launch off of the stall, it hesitates - usually three pulses - it tries to go then lets off, then tries to go and lets off, then tries to go and lets off, then finally it goes. They are real brief pulses, but it's enough to really mess up the times. Any one have any idea?
